Comfort

A sectional sleeper sofa that has a chaise offers the comfort of a comfy couch and a pull-out sleeper in one furniture piece. It's a great solution for homeowners who often host guests or have children who require a place to stay.

There are several aspects to take into consideration when you are looking for a sectional with a sleeper lounge. This will allow you find the ideal design and features to suit your home. Begin by determining the dimensions and shape of the item. You might prefer a U-shaped or L-shaped model, depending on the arrangement of your living space. Some sectional beds come with an ottoman that doubles as a storage space, making it easy to access bedding and other bedroom essentials.

The mattress is an additional consideration when shopping for a sectional with an out-of-the-way bed. There are mattresses made from foam, memory foam, and innerspring materials. Each provides a distinct degree of comfort. Foam cushions are light and soft memory foam cushions conform to the body, while innerspring mattresses offer traditional support. Foam mattresses are a good option if you plan to use the sectional mostly to sit on. Memory foam and innerspring models on the other hand are the best choices for those who will sleep on pull-out beds.

Durability

When shopping for a sectional sleeper sofa or a chaise, consider what kind of fabric it's upholstered with. Performance fabrics, like those available from West Elm Apt2B, and Room & Board, have been tested to ensure they resist punctures and tears. This makes them perfect for households with children and pets or high traffic rooms. The spills and stains are easily cleaned. Choose products that are woven to resist snags and have a Martindale Cycle Rating of at least 3 piece sectional with chaise,000.

If you are looking for a sectional that includes bed, be sure you select the mattress size that best suits your needs. Some sleepers in sectional sleepers have twin-sized beds, whereas others have queen-size or full-size mattresses. Other sleeper sectional styles include futons, convertible chaises and storage models.

When shopping for a sectional with a pull-out mattress ensure that the fabric is durable enough to withstand repeated usage. Fabric should be stain-resistant and easy to clean, whereas foam padding must be strong and durable. The spring or innerspring is a different aspect to take into consideration. It is designed to prevent the mattress from sliding with time.

A chaise is a part of couch that extends out from the corner, forming an inviting space for you to relax. A chaise lounge is perfect to read or watching a show and some of the most comfortable sectional sofas for sleepers come with one.
